As a rule of thumb, the minimum required battery capacity for a 12-volt system is around 20 % of the inverter capacity. For 24-volt inverters, it is 10 %. The battery capacity for a 12-volt Mass Sine 12/1200, for instance, is 240 Ah, while a 24-volt Mass Sine 24/1500 inverter would require at least 150 Ah.

The indicated battery capacity is only for the inverter. The capacity required for other loads should be added to it. How much power does an inverter consume?
In the case of a 12V inverter, the start inverter voltage is typically around 9.5VDC. This threshold ensures that the inverter can begin its operation reliably without placing undue stress on the connected battery. What is cut off voltage in inverter?

An inverter battery typically operates at 12V, 24V, or 48V. These voltages represent the nominal direct current (DC) needed for the inverter''s function.
